Mazda CX-5 Fuel Economy Specifications
The Mazda CX-5 delivers impressive fuel economy figures for a compact SUV, balancing performance with efficiency. The fuel consumption varies depending on the engine configuration, drivetrain type, and model year. Typically, the CX-5 is available with a naturally aspirated 2.5-liter four-cylinder engine and a turbocharged option, both designed to optimize fuel usage without sacrificing power.
Engine Options and Fuel Economy Ratings
For the most recent model years, the base 2.5-liter inline-four engine offers EPA-estimated fuel economy ratings of approximately 25 miles per gallon (mpg) in the city and 31 mpg on the highway for front-wheel-drive models. All-wheel-drive variants slightly reduce these numbers to around 24 mpg city and 30 mpg highway.
The turbocharged 2.5-liter engine, while providing increased horsepower and torque, generally achieves slightly lower fuel economy, averaging about 22 mpg city and 27 mpg highway. These figures reflect the balance between enhanced performance and fuel efficiency.
Transmission and Drivetrain Impact
The Mazda CX-5 comes equipped with a six-speed automatic transmission that contributes to smooth gear shifts and efficient power delivery. The choice between front-wheel drive (FWD) and all-wheel drive (AWD) also affects fuel economy. AWD models tend to consume more fuel due to additional drivetrain components and weight, resulting in lower mileage compared to their FWD counterparts.

Comparing Mazda CX-5 Fuel Economy to Competitors
In the compact SUV segment, the Mazda CX-5 faces competition from models like the Honda CR-V, Toyota RAV4, and Subaru Forester. Evaluating fuel economy across these vehicles helps highlight the CX-5’s standing.
Fuel Efficiency Comparison Overview
The Mazda CX-5 generally offers competitive fuel economy figures. For example, the Honda CR-V achieves about 28 mpg city and 34 mpg highway, while the Toyota RAV4 delivers close to 27 mpg city and 35 mpg highway. The Subaru Forester, known for standard AWD, averages around 26 mpg city and 33 mpg highway.
Despite slightly lower highway mpg compared to some rivals, the CX-5 compensates with sportier handling and premium interior features, making it an attractive option for drivers prioritizing driving experience alongside fuel economy.
Hybrid and Alternative Fuel Options Among Competitors
Some competitors offer hybrid variants that significantly boost fuel efficiency. For instance, the Toyota RAV4 Hybrid achieves upwards of 40 mpg combined. Mazda has announced plans to introduce hybrid and electric models in the future, which may enhance fuel economy options for the CX-5 lineup.

Emissions and Regulatory Compliance
The Mazda CX-5 complies with stringent emissions standards, incorporating technologies such as direct fuel injection and cylinder deactivation to minimize pollutants. These features not only improve fuel economy but also support environmental sustainability goals.
